SOCCER AID: ENGLAND AND WORLD XI SQUADS REVEALED

Soccer Aid for UNICEF 2024 will take place on Sunday 9 June at Stamford Bridge, London with England taking on the Soccer Aid World XI FC in the world’s biggest celebrity football match.



Watch international sporting legends come together with top celebrities to battle it out on the pitch this summer. Returning fan favourites Usain Bolt, Jill Scott, Tommy Fury, Robbie Williams and others will be joined by exciting new signings including Eden Hazard, Stuart Broad and Sam Thompson as Soccer Aid returns to London for 2024.



Lacing up their boots again this year are team favourites Usain Bolt, Sir Mo Farah Roman Kemp, Martin Compston and Steven Bartlett joining footballing legends Jermain Defoe, Jill Scott, David James, Gary Cahill, Joe Cole and Karen Carney.


New signings for this summer include cricketer Stuart Broad, King of the Jungle Sam Thompson, Strictly Come Dancing star Bobby Brazier and footballing legend – and former Chelsea icon – Eden Hazard. Also joining are Theo Wallcott and Ellen White.



Frank Lampard joins Harry Redknapp and Robbie Williams as England manager. Facing them down will be Mauricio Pochettino, returning as manager for Soccer Aid World XI.



The live show will be hosted by UNICEF UK Ambassador Dermot O’Leary, who will be joined once again by UNICEF UK High Profile Supporter, Alex Scott.



Created by Robbie Williams in 2006, Soccer Aid for UNICEF brings the nation together to help children worldwide have the best possible start in life. Once a year, England take on their opponents, the Soccer Aid World XI FC.


Supported by passionate fans in an iconic stadium and broadcast live on ITV and STV, the event harnesses the power of football to help make sure that children can grow up happy, healthy and able to play.
